BF52 KWX is a 2002 Ldv 200 in Red with a 1,905c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 12 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 58.3%.

Across all 2002 Ldv 200 models, the average MOT pass rate is 67.9% with a typical mileage of 64,274 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Ldv 200 fails its MOT is brake pipe excessively corroded, accounting for 2,547 recorded failures. If you're considering buying BF52 KWX,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Ldv 200 typically stays on UK roads for around 37 years. At 24 years old, this Ldv 200 is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
